Our Commercial Radon Services in Fort Shawnee

Commercial buildings demand different protocols than single-family homes. Larger footprints, multiple foundation types, varying HVAC zones, and stricter compliance documentation all change the math. Here is what our professional Commercial Radon Services Fort Shawnee OH team delivers:

Multi-Point Commercial Radon Testing

Per AARST-CCAH MAMF and MA-MFLB protocols, commercial and multi-family buildings require multiple test locations — typically 10% of ground-contact units, plus common areas, mechanical rooms, and elevator pits. We deploy continuous radon monitors (CRMs) that log hourly readings for 48 hours minimum, producing tamper-evident reports that satisfy lenders, attorneys, and code officials.

Active Soil Depressurization (ASD) Mitigation Systems

ASD is the gold standard for permanent radon reduction. For Fort Shawnee commercial properties, we engineer custom suction-point layouts based on slab geometry, sub-slab communication testing, and building pressure dynamics. Systems include sealed PVC vent stacks, U-tube manometers, radon fans rated for continuous duty, and roof or sidewall discharge points routed to comply with ANSI/AARST RMS-MF and RMS-LB standards.

Apartment Complex & Multi-Family Compliance

Ohio landlords face growing liability exposure when tenants test elevated radon. We design building-wide mitigation strategies for garden-style, mid-rise, and townhouse properties, including documentation packages for insurance carriers and HUD-financed assets requiring AARST-NRPP compliance.

School & Public Facility Radon Programs

Ohio Department of Health and EPA guidance recommends radon testing every five years in K-12 buildings. We handle full district-level testing campaigns, mitigation of flagged classrooms, and the long-term monitoring documentation administrators need for board reporting and parent communication.

Our Process — From First Call to Post-Mitigation Verification

The best Commercial Radon Services Fort Shawnee providers earn that label by following a disciplined, repeatable methodology. Here is ours:

  1. Site Assessment & Quote (Day 1): Phone or on-site walkthrough. We collect square footage, foundation type, HVAC layout, and prior test results. A flat-rate written quote arrives within 24 hours — no "call for pricing" runaround.
  2. Diagnostic Testing (Days 2–4): Continuous radon monitors deployed per AARST-CCAH protocol. Closed-building conditions enforced. Data downloaded and analyzed by a licensed RC202 professional.
  3. System Design & Permitting (Days 5–7): Sub-slab communication test, suction-point mapping, fan sizing, discharge routing. We pull required Allen County permits.
  4. Installation (Days 8–10): Most commercial systems install in 1–3 days. Sealed PVC, certified radon fans, manometer, labeling per ANSI/AARST standards.
  5. Verification & Documentation: Post-mitigation CRM test confirms levels below 4.0 pCi/L (we target below 2.0). Final report delivered for your records, your lender, or your buyer.

Fort Shawnee's geology is a textbook radon producer. The village sits atop fractured limestone bedrock and glacial till soils that channel radon gas upward through basement floors, crawlspace vapor barriers, and slab cracks. Older commercial buildings along Fort Amanda Road, Breese Road, and South Dixie Highway often pre-date radon-resistant construction codes entirely.

We've worked across Allen County — from properties near Shawnee High School to commercial corridors connecting Fort Shawnee with Lima, Cridersville, and Wapakoneta. Our crews understand the specific challenges of buildings near the Ottawa River floodplain, where high water tables complicate sub-slab depressurization design, and the unique HVAC patterns of older flat-roofed retail and office structures common along the OH-65 corridor.

Pricing — What Commercial Radon Services Cost in Fort Shawnee

Generic Google answers won't tell you what a real Fort Shawnee commercial radon project costs. Here's the honest range:

  • Commercial radon testing (small office/retail under 5,000 sq ft): $300–$650 flat rate
  • Multi-family / apartment building testing: $150–$250 per test location, volume pricing for 10+ units
  • School / large facility testing campaigns: custom-quoted based on building count and test point density
  • Single-suction-point mitigation system (small commercial): $1,800–$3,200
  • Multi-point commercial mitigation: $4,500–$15,000+ depending on building size and complexity
  • Apartment-wide mitigation programs: custom-engineered, typically $1,200–$2,500 per building point

How do I choose a commercial radon services provider in Fort Shawnee?

Verify three things: (1) the Ohio mitigation license number on every proposal, (2) AARST-NRPP or NRSB national certification, and (3) written flat-rate pricing with post-mitigation verification testing included. Anyone who won't share their license number or insists on "call for pricing" should be skipped.

What should I look for in commercial radon services?

Compliance with ANSI/AARST RMS-MF (multi-family) and RMS-LB (large buildings) standards, sub-slab communication testing as part of design, continuous radon monitor (CRM) verification rather than charcoal canisters, sealed PVC vent stacks, code-rated fans, and documentation suitable for lenders, insurers, and code officials.

How long does commercial radon services take?

Testing requires a minimum 48 hours of closed-building conditions. Most small commercial mitigation systems install in 1–2 days; larger multi-point or apartment-wide projects run 3–10 days.
